Environmental Impact Analysis



Solar energy presents an encouraging alternative to conventional power sources because of its significantly reduced environmental impact. Unlike fossil fuels that give off dangerous greenhouse gases and add to air contamination, solar power produces power without producing any kind of emissions.

The process of harnessing solar power involves catching sunlight with photovoltaic panels, which does not release any toxins into the atmosphere. This lack of emissions helps reduce the carbon footprint related to energy production, making solar energy a cleaner and more lasting option.

Furthermore, using solar power contributes to preservation initiatives by minimizing the need for finite sources like coal, oil, and natural gas. By relying on the sun's abundant and renewable resource source, we can help maintain all-natural habitats, protect ecosystems, and mitigate the adverse effects of resource extraction.

Integrity and Power Landscape Analysis



For a thorough assessment of dependability and the power landscape, it's vital to examine exactly how solar power contrasts to standard sources. Solar power is pushing on as a trustworthy and lasting energy source. While conventional sources like coal, oil, and gas have actually been historically dominant, they're finite and add to environmental degradation.

Solar power, on the other hand, is bountiful and eco-friendly, making it an extra sustainable alternative over time.

In regards to integrity, solar power can be dependent on weather and sunshine schedule. However, improvements in innovation have actually caused the development of power storage space services like batteries, boosting the integrity of solar energy systems. Conventional resources, on the other hand, are prone to rate variations, geopolitical tensions, and supply chain disturbances, making them much less reputable in the long term.

When assessing the power landscape, solar energy provides decentralized power manufacturing, minimizing transmission losses and raising power security. Typical sources, with their central power plants, are extra prone to disruptions and need substantial framework for circulation.
